Why Is Jimmy Kimmel’s Show a Rerun Tonight? Was He Canceled Again?

Published 09/27/2025, 8:46 AM EDT

The Friday night rerun of Jimmy Kimmel Live! will air on both Sinclair and Nexstar stations. It will be a rerun of Tuesday's show. After making a triumphant comeback following the brief cancellation over his remarks about Charlie Kirk, new episodes will air Monday through Thursday. Kimmel's celebrated comeback on ABC happened before Sinclair finalized plans to bring him back, so audiences of the station had not yet seen his return. But now, fans can finally witness this pivotal, heartfelt resurgence on national television.

Earlier this week, Disney confirmed that Jimmy Kimmel Live! would return after backlash over its suspension, yet Sinclair and Nexstar, controlling over 20 percent of ABC affiliates, initially refused to air the show. After his return to the show, Kimmel condemned the affiliates, declaring, "That is not legal. That is not American. It is un-American." Three days later, both operators reversed their decision, announcing the program would resume on their stations, ending the week-long boycott and allowing viewers to witness Kimmel’s triumphant return.

During his first show back on air, Jimmy Kimmel addressed the controversy surrounding Charlie Kirk’s death, emphasizing that he never intended to make light of the situation. He stressed that he did not aim to blame any group for the actions of a deeply disturbed individual. Jimmy Kimmel Live! returns: Guide to streaming without paying

Fans eager to watch Jimmy Kimmel Live! without cable have several exciting streaming options. The show airs on ABC and is available through internet-based services like DirecTV, Fubo, and Hulu + Live TV. By signing up for a five-day free trial on DirecTV, viewers can watch the show at no cost. Paid plans start at $49.99 for the first month and include ABC along with popular channels such as ESPN, AMC, Bravo, CNBC, and Disney Channel, offering a full entertainment experience.

Fans can aslso stream Jimmy Kimmel Live! on services offering vast channel selections. Hulu provides over 95 live channels, including BET, CNN, Food Network, HGTV, MTV, and FX, along with access to Hulu’s full streaming library, Disney+, and ESPN+. Hulu offers a three-day free trial for viewers to try before committing. Sling TV is an affordable alternative, with the Sling Blue plan including ABC, NBC, Fox, Discovery, Disney Channel, CNN, and more, often discounted for the first month.
